About St Elizabeth’s
Set within 60 acres of beautiful Hertfordshire countryside, St Elizabeth’s is a values-led charity supporting children, young people and adults with epilepsy and complex needs. Our integrated services include education, residential care, supported living and day opportunities, creating a unique and rewarding environment where every role contributes to improving lives.

About the Role
As Senior HR Advisor, you will provide professional, expert HR advice and guidance to managers across the organisation, supporting a wide range of employee relations matters and helping ensure best practice, legal compliance and positive workplace outcomes.
Working closely with the Head of People Relations and Policy, you will play a key role in managing complex casework, supporting organisational change, coaching managers and contributing to the delivery of strategic people initiatives.

Key responsibilities include:

Advising managers and senior leaders on complex employee relations matters, including disciplinary, grievance, capability, absence management and organisational change
Supporting investigations, hearings and formal processes, ensuring compliance with employment legislation and organisational policies
Leading on employment-related legal matters, including Subject Access Requests and supporting Employment Tribunal and ACAS cases
Coaching and developing managers to build confidence and capability in managing people issues
Supporting organisational change and restructures
Producing and analysing workforce and employee relations data to identify trends and drive improvements
Coaching and mentoring the HR Advisor, supporting their development and day-to-day activities
Contributing to policy development, governance initiatives and continuous service improvement
Designing and delivering manager training and development sessions
Deputising for the Head of People Relations and Policy when required
This role offers genuine variety, strategic exposure and the opportunity to influence people practices across a large and diverse organisation.
